Actor-Director-Producer Dhanush made his debut in the West with the film The Extraordinary Journey of the Fakir which is directed by Ken Scott. Dhanush plays a rural young Indian in the film and is on a journey across Europe and what transpires while he travel forms the story. Well, Dhanush has added another feather to his cap with his debut foreign film. The Extraordinary Journey of the Fakir has bagged an international award. The film has won the Audience Award for Best Comedy at the Barcelona Sant-Jordi International Film Festival. The film that was screened last year in France is all set to release this year in India.
The Extraordinary Journey of the Fakir will also have a Tamil version, which is titled as Vazhkaiya Thedi Naanum Ponaen. The film is based on a book of the same title The Extraordinary Journey of the Fakir, which was released in 2014. The story is about a boy Ajatushatru, played by Dhanush, who is on a journey to find his missing father. The Extraordinary Journey of the Fakir also stars Bérénice Bejo, Barkhad Abdi and Erin Moriarty in important roles.
Last year, during the premiere of the film in Paris, director Scott spoke about how working with actors from the different cultural background was inspirational. Sharing his experience, Scott said, “I fell in love with the project. Working with Dhanush and other actors from so many different cultures was truly inspiring. We shot in different countries — India, Italy, France, Libya. We wanted to impact these different countries to the main character. Very simply what I tried to do is to get the best out of each actor to find the right balance of drama and comedy.”
